Tomorrow at 1:00 p.m., Education and Workforce Committee Chairman Tim Walberg (R-MI) will participate in a press conference to address the rise of antisemitism on college campuses across the United States. The press conference will take place ahead of the Committee’s hearing titled “Beyond the Ivy League: Stopping the Spread of Antisemitism on American Campuses.”
Chairman Walberg will be joined by House Republican Conference Chairwoman Lisa McClain (R-MI), Rep. Randy Fine (R-FL), and Michael Kaminsky, a third-year student at DePaul University who was assaulted on campus in the wake of the October 7th attack.
